Machiya Stay in Gojo, Near Gion and Kyoto Sta.

The house was an Ochaya (literally "tea house")before and we renovated it, which is an establishment where patrons are entertained by geisha. We kept the original structure and make it much more modern and comfortable. The river in front of the house is the must-see in Kyoto changing from cherry bloom to maples. The best location near Gojo bridge and Kiyomizuーgojo sta. can make it very convenient to all the famous spots.

【Kyotofish·Miya】Geisha District Private Machiya

Originally built as a traditional teahouse in Kyoto’s geisha district, this historic house preserves many original details, including a second-floor space once used for geisha performances. The restoration was designed by Kyoto machiya architect Shigeyuki Uoya, blending traditional structure with modern comfort. A quiet stay inside a rare piece of Kyoto’s flower district culture.
